原文:SQL Server高级进阶之表分区删除

一 引言 删除分区又称为合并分区,简单地讲就是将多个分区的数据进行合并。现以表Sales.SalesOrderHeader作为示例,演示如何进行表分区删除。 重要的事情说三遍:备份数据库 备份数据库 备份数据库 二 演示 . 数据查询 查看分区元数据 统计每个分区的数据量 分区表中有数据时,是不能够删除分区方案和分区函数的,只能将数据先移到其它表中,再删除。 . 删除实操 . . 合并原表分区 . ...

2021-09-29 15:51 0 227 推荐指数:

查看详情

SQL Server高级进阶分区表创建

一、分区表概念 1.1、什么是分区表分区表是在SQL Server 2005之后的版本引入的特性,这个特性允许把逻辑上的一个在物理上分为很多部分。换句话说,分区表从物理上看是将一个大分成几个小,但是从逻辑上看,还是一个大。 1.2、分区与分的区别 分区:就是把一张的数据 ...

Tue Sep 28 22:18:00 CST 2021 0 157
(3)SQL Server分区

。比如将前半年订单放一个历史分区表,不活跃库存放一个历史分区表。截止到SQL Server 2016,一张或一 ...

Wed Apr 08 20:03:00 CST 2020 6 1185
8、SQL Server 分区

什么是分区分区其实就是将一个大分成若干个小分区可以从物理上将一个大分成几个小,但是逻辑上还是一个。所以当执行插入、更新等操作的时候,不需要我们去判断应该插入或更新到哪个中。只需要插入大中就可以了。SQL Server会自动的将它放在对应的中。对于查询也是一样,直接查询大 ...

Tue Aug 11 21:07:00 CST 2015 2 1530
Sql Server 分区

sql server自2005开始支持分区特性,2012 以前单分区数量限制1000个,2012开始限制数量为15000个,企业版才支分区特性,目前版本只支持范围分区一种,相比oracle 支持范围、列表、哈希以及子分区特性,功能还有不少的差距。 一、分区的优势: 1、通过分区交换 ...

Fri Dec 17 02:38:00 CST 2021 0 1383
SQL Server分区

什么是分区 一般情况下,我们建立数据库时,数据都存放在一个文件里。 但是如果是分区表的话,数据就会按照你指定的规则分放到不同的文件里,把一个大的数据文件拆分为多个小文件,还可以把这些小文件放在不同的磁盘下由多个cpu进行处理。这样文件的大小随着拆分而减小,还得到硬件系统的加强,自然 ...

Tue Apr 29 17:01:00 CST 2014 33 124376
T-SQL查询进阶--理解SQL SERVER中的分区表

简介 分区表是在SQL SERVER2005之后的版本引入的特性。这个特性允许把逻辑上的一个在物理上分为很多部分。而对于SQL SERVER2005之前版本,所谓的分区表仅仅是分布式视图,也就是多个做union操作. 分区表在逻辑上是一个,而物理上是多个.这意味着 ...

Sat Dec 31 01:19:00 CST 2011 31 19527
SQL Server 分区表

分区表简介   分区表SQL Server2005新引入的概念,这个特性在逻辑上将一个在物理上分为多个部分。(即它允许将一个存储在不同的物理磁盘里)。在SQL Server2005之前,分区表实际上是分布式视图,也就是多个做union操作。   分区表在逻辑上是一个,而物理上是多个 ...

Thu Jun 27 00:08:00 CST 2013 3 10552
SQL Server分区的操作

背景: 大多数项目开发中都会有几个日志用于记录用户操作或者数据变更的信息,往往这些数据数据量比较庞大,每次对这些数据进行操作都比较费时,这个时候就考虑用分区对表进行切分到不同物理磁盘进行存储,从而提高运行效率。 分区优点: 1.性能提升:最大的好处应该是 ...

Thu Mar 09 22:08:00 CST 2017 2 4071
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M